Lost Friendship



When you see someone you love,
and can no longer hold their hand,
It matters not whether its woman or man.
You realize the sadness it brings
as a friendship lost sometimes bleeds the soul
and all that is left is the memory you hold.

Written by: Melvina Germain
Date: July 25/2015
